elasmobranch

noun elas·mo·branch \i-ˈlaz-mə-ˌbraŋk\
plural elas·mo·branchs

Definition of ELASMOBRANCH

:  any of a subclass (Elasmobranchii) of cartilaginous fishes that have five to seven lateral to ventral gill openings on each side and that comprise the sharks, rays, skates, and extinct related fishes
elasmobranch adjective

Origin of ELASMOBRANCH

ultimately from Greek elasmos metal plate (from elaunein) + branchia gills
First Known Use: 1872
